On dyno 418 HP
Runs were from 10.8 something to 10.9 something at 74 mph. (1/8 mile track)
I was launching in 2WD, had a load of firewood in the back, Tires were still aired up to 60 psi from hauling the camper and the airbags still had air in them and I have major wheel hop from no traction bars.
No doubt I could have done better but I just wanted to run for the heck of it. Blow a little smoke on the SD's. LOL
I won 4 out of 8 races but most was lost due to my inexperience at the track. See that was my first time down a strip. My first couple of launches were at too low RPM. I had to try and figure out what was best to launch at. As it turns out 3000 RPM is the best otherwise she falls on her face at the line.
